Sometimes I feel like I was born in the wrong year - I think it would have been cool to be alive in the '60s.
The quote "Sometimes I feel like I was born in the wrong year - I think it would have been cool to be alive in the '60s." by Charli XCX reflects her sense of nostalgia and fascination with the 1960s, a decade known for its cultural upheaval, iconic music, and social movements. Charli XCX, a contemporary pop artist, expresses a longing to have experienced the energy and revolutionary spirit of the '60s, a time when many artistic and societal shifts took place, particularly in music, fashion, and civil rights. Her statement suggests that she feels a connection to the era's spirit, possibly due to its creativity and boldness.
The origin of this quote comes from Charli XCX’s artistic expression and interest in different cultural periods. As a pop artist known for her avant-garde style and experimental music, Charli XCX often draws inspiration from past eras to shape her work. Her statement about the '60s reflects her admiration for the bold, innovative atmosphere of the time, especially in music, where artists like The Beatles, Jimi Hendrix, and The Supremes were pushing boundaries. The '60s was also a decade marked by significant social change, which could resonate with Charli’s desire to be part of a time of transformation.
In this context, Charli XCX’s statement highlights how artists often feel a deep connection to previous decades, especially those filled with cultural movements that align with their own values or creative expressions. The idea of being "born in the wrong year" expresses her yearning for a different time, where the environment may have seemed more conducive to the artistic freedom and countercultural exploration she values.
Ultimately, this quote reveals Charli XCX's appreciation for the '60s and its vibrant cultural energy, which influenced much of the art and music we admire today. Though born in a different era, her connection to the spirit of that time shows how artists often draw on past influences to shape the future of their creative work, blending nostalgia with modern expression.
